Code. Create. Game. Repeat – Best Laptops of 2025 Edition!

If you’re looking for a powerful laptop in 2025 that can handle coding, gaming, and video editing, we’ve compiled a list of the best all-rounders. Whether you’re a software developer, a creative editor, or a hardcore gamer, these laptops offer the perfect blend of performance, display, battery, and graphics power.

Top Picks for 2025

1. Apple MacBook Pro 16-inch (M3 Max)

  • Best For: Video editing & coding (macOS)
  • Specs:
    • Apple M3 Max chip
    • Up to 64GB RAM
    • Up to 2TB SSD
    • Liquid Retina XDR display
  • Why Buy: Exceptional for Final Cut Pro, Xcode, smooth thermal performance
  • Drawback: Not ideal for Windows-based game libraries

2. ASUS ROG Zephyrus G16 (2025)

  • Best For: Gaming & content creation
  • Specs:
    • Intel Core Ultra 9
    • N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4080
    • 32GB RAM, 1TB SSD
    • 240Hz QHD+ display
  • Why Buy: Powerful GPU, solid battery life, great for Unreal/Unity, DaVinci Resolve

3. Dell XPS 16 (2025)

  • Best For: Coding, multitasking, and editing
  • Specs:
    • Intel Core Ultra 7/9
    • Intel Arc/Optional NVIDIA GPU
    • Up to 64GB RAM
    • OLED display
  • Why Buy: Premium design, AI-powered performance, great for developers and editors

4. Lenovo Legion Pro 7i Gen 9

  • Best For: Hardcore gaming + high-end programming
  • Specs:
    • Intel Core i9-14900HX
    • RTX 4090
    • 32GB RAM, 2TB SSD
    • 240Hz QHD display
  • Why Buy: Built for AAA games and resource-heavy tasks like machine learning

5. HP Spectre x360 16 (2025)

  • Best For: Versatile use – coding, light gaming, and content creation
  • Specs:
    • Intel Core Ultra 7
    • Integrated Intel Graphics
    • 16GB RAM, 1TB SSD
    • 3K OLED touch display
  • Why Buy: 2-in-1 flexibility, lightweight, stylish, ideal for creators and devs

Key Features to Consider

  • Processor (CPU): Look for Intel Core Ultra 7/9, Apple M3, or AMD Ryzen 9
  • Graphics (GPU): RTX 4070/4080/4090 for gaming/editing, integrated GPU for coding
  • RAM: Minimum 16GB; 32GB+ preferred for editing/gaming
  • Storage: At least 512GB SSD for speed and software handling
  • Display: High-refresh rate (120Hz+), color-accurate screen for editing

Conclusion you need to know

The best laptop for you depends on what you prioritize more—gaming performance, video editing power, or a lightweight device for daily development tasks. For maximum versatility, the ASUS ROG Zephyrus G16 and Dell XPS 16 stand out as perfect all-in-one solutions in 2025.
